    It's a rarity in this day of fast pace service to truly experience what first class customer…read moreservice really looks like. After a few visits to Lemon Cabana I can share with you what this particular Virginia Beach store does right, and why it should be a model for others to emulate. My daughter has been a fan of the Oceanfront store for a few years primarily due to their selection of OnU necklaces which are very hot with not only young ladies but adult women as well. We have purchased a few of them and enjoyed browsing the store. The location off Laskin is one block from the Oceanfront and Atlantic Ave. Parking in their rear lot is FREE and the store can be accessed by a rear entrance. Parking in front is by meter. The store's walk up in front and back has been clean and neat. The business is situated on a short strip with a couple other businesses. I love the 60's retro feel of the building. Lemon carries home decor, ladies beach fashion, books and lots of unique items that you can't easily find else where. They are well known for a fantastic selection of costume jewelry. The store may be smallish, but it's packed with goodies. The feel is fresh, bright and service immediately welcoming. On every occasion there has been one of the two-three ladies ask if they can assist with no pressure to purchase. Yesterday while visiting my daughter wanted to purchase a OnU necklace. The inventory was depleted as a shipment is due in soon. Chic instructed us to follow their Instagram page which would announce the arrival of the shipment. My daughter happen to be wearing her OnU necklace and had a stubborn knot in it. Chic offered to work on it while we got lunch. Upon returning an hour later the knot was out to a happy young lady. No charge, just a very nice smile from Chic and will see you soon. This is first class service. Thank you Chic and Lemmon Cabana.

    Painted Tree Boutique is, by far, one of the coolest shops I've been to in VB. While I was out…read moreshopping for my daughter's birthday, I saw a few people walking into the store and was very curious to see if I could find a cute gift for her inside. I was blown away with what I had walked in to, I'd like to think of it as an upscale flea market. The store included specialized gifts, decor, jewelry, clothes, home goods, paintings, record albums, snacks, candles, plants, art...all under one roof. You name it, they have it. After walking around for over an hour looking at each vendor, I decided to buy my daughter a pair of socks (they have an abundance of awesome socks) and fun snacks. As I was checking out, the lady shared that they currently have over 270 vendors within the store and that they change often. There was also a "Ladies Night" event that week which included amazing sales, live music and gift card giveaways! All of the prices were fairly decent as well. If you are looking for a gift for someone or just want to buy something for yourself, Painted Tree is definitely the place to go!!!
